DJOP cites danger of another Trump candidacy

Former President Donald Trump’s plan to run again in 2024 “means a return to the divisiveness and fact-free public discourse that marked his years in office,” Democratic Jewish Outreach Pennsylvania (DJOP) said today.

In a statement by the political action committee’s board of directors, DJOP called last night’s announcement by Trump “a transparent ploy to shield himself from any number of state and federal legal investigations confronting him,” including charges that he  pressured state officials to overturn the 2020 election results, incited the violent January 6, 2021 insurrectionists, stole classified documents and took them to his private club in Mar-a-Lago, and headed businesses that committed financial irregularities in New York City.

Jill Zipin, Chair of DJOP, said that even though Trump exaggerated the accomplishments and ignored the failures of his four years in office, “we do not take his run lightly.”  She said:

“Donald Trump is a threat to democracy and to both Democratic and Jewish values.   His Make America Great Again followers remain committed to him and are fully prepared to work for his reelection.  But we as Jewish Democrats will do all we can to ensure that a twice-impeached insurrectionist never holds the office of President again.

“We reject Donald Trump’s politics of division, and the anti-freedom politics of his party’s wanna-be Trump imitators.”

Zipin said the nation “cannot afford a return to the discord that marked the Trump administration, nor his ranting and policies that Kevin D. Williamson, correspondent for The Dispatch, described in the Nov. 15 New York Times as ‘deformed, depraved, backward and, in the end, fundamentally anti-American.’”
